In this solemn and urgent sermon, E.A. Johnston vividly portrays the terrifying reality of hell and the eternal suffering of godless sinners. Drawing from Scripture, he exposes the spiritual blindness and indifference that lead many to ignore God's warnings. Johnston calls listeners to recognize the certainty of divine judgment and the dreadful consequences of sin, urging repentance and faith before it is too late.

Sermon Outline
-
I. The Reality of Hell's Torments
- Hell is a place of intense, eternal suffering
- The damned cry out with unbearable pain
- Scripture vividly describes the fearful nature of hell
-
II. The Unawareness and Indifference of Sinners
- Sinners often deny or ignore the reality of hell
- They indulge in sin without fear of judgment
- Their hearts are hardened and blind to God's warnings
-
III. The Certainty of God's Judgment
- God's wrath is just and inevitable
- Sin must be punished according to divine justice
- The day of reckoning will come suddenly and surely
-
IV. The Eternal Consequences and Hopelessness in Hell
- The damned are trapped forever in torment
- No remorse or repentance can save them after death
- Their suffering is continuous and increasing
